Quality of Products. 5.1 Subject to 11.2 Morcan gives no warranty to the Client in respect of any Product that is purchased by Morcan from a Supplier for resale to the Client but shall take reasonable steps to assist the Client in making available claims under Supplier or manufacturer product warranties, subject to compliance by the Client with any warranty terms as provided by the Supplier/manufacturer. Morcan will accept returns of faulty Products notified to Morcan within 14 days of delivery, subject to the terms of the relevant Supplier’s/manufacturer's warranty. After 14 days the Client will need to deal with the manufacturer directly. All returns of Products can only be made if they comply with the following: a. Prior authorisation for return must be obtained from Morcan. The Client should use the contact details shown on the Order for this purpose; b. The Products in issue must be returned within 5 days of the authorisation to return under 5.1(a); c. The Products must be properly packed and delivered to the return address notified by Morcan on DDP Incoterms 2010, together with any forms or information and in accordance with any procedure notified by Morcan; d. The Goods must still be covered by the relevant Supplier’s/manufacturer’s warranty. The following (non-exhaustive) list of examples are all likely to invalidate or give rise to the loss of benefit of Supplier/manufacturer warranties: Use of products after notification under 5.1(a); failure to follow Supplier/manufacturer instructions as to storage, installation, commissioning, use or maintenance; unauthorised alteration or repair; fair wear and tear, wilful damage, negligence, abnormal working conditions, or defects arising as a result of Client’s design or instructions. Morcan reserves the right to test (or permit testing of) all Products returned as faulty and to return to the Client (at the Client’s expense) any Products found not to be faulty, or ineligible for repair, replacement or refund under applicable Supplier/manufacturer’s warranties. 5.2 All Products supplied which are Software are only supplied “as is". The sole obligation of Morcan in connection with the supply of Products which are Software is to use reasonable endeavours to obtain and supply a corrected version from the Supplier concerned in the event that such Software should fail to conform to the Published Software Specification, provided always that the Client notifies Morcan of any such non- conformity within 30 days of the date of delivery of the applicable Software Products.
